Micro Live

on BBC Two England

A weekly look at the world of computers and information technology.
Long Distance Information Electronic information is changing the way we do business - forcing even the most ancient British institutions to update themselves.
Andrew Neil, Editor of the Sunday Times, gives a special report on the way that the Stock Exchange, Fleet Street and the legal profession are falling dangerously behind as they struggle to keep pace with the booming electronic information market.
Eddy Shah talks about new opportunies to start your own newspaper; a leading barrister admits that now the law is electronic he makes fewer mistakes; while a computer programmer from the Stock Exchange is afraid that his work will destroy the Exchange's famous trading floor.
